AASA Names Paul McCarthy As New Head As Aftermarket Industry Faces Important Challenges

McCarthy comes up through AASA’s top leadership, where he had served nearly three years as second in command and executive vice president to AASA’s previous President and Chief Operating Officer Bill Long. Long was named president and CEO of AASA’s parent organization, the Motor & Equipment Manufacturers Association (MEMA), in February.

52 Technicians Honored At ASE Annual Meeting 

Forty-one companies from both the OEM and aftermarket segments sponsored the individual technician recognition awards in the Auto, Truck, Collision, Parts and Service categories, along with awards for automotive instructors. In addition to looking for top scores on ASE tests, award sponsors examine on-the-job excellence, community service and other factors when selecting honorees.

Women’s Industry Network Elects Board Leadership For 2018-’19 Term

The WIN board of directors exists to guide the organization in furthering the group’s mission. The all-volunteer group represents various collision industry segments including, but not limited to, repair facilities, suppliers, consultants, information providers and insurance companies.

Automotive Maintenance And Repair Expo 2018 Offers Insight Into China’s Evolving Automotive Aftermarket

Housing 1,200 exhibitors and 57,117 trade visitors from 70 countries and regions, the fair offered participants sourcing options, connections and industry knowledge, each of which are much needed for establishing a more sustainable business in the fast-changing Chinese market.

The Women’s Industry Network Announces Recipients Of The 2018 Most Influential Women In Collision Repair Award

The Most Influential Women award was established in 1999 to recognize the achievements of women in the collision repair industry. Since then, more than 80 women have been recognized for their contributions to the industry.
